Spreadsheet to Web App Development for Business Workflows

Converting a spreadsheet to a web app means defining the records, rules, screens, and user actions behind the file. A useful migration also identifies which historical data to move and how the team will switch without losing track of work in progress.

FROM WORKFLOW TO WORKING SOFTWARE

What the engagement covers.

01

Understand the workbook

Map sheets, formulas, macros, manual corrections, and files that supply data. Identify who uses each part and what decisions it supports.

02

Define a focused application

Agree the record model, access roles, validations, and essential screens. Separate the first useful release from later improvements.

03

Rehearse the data move

Clean and map a representative sample, compare counts and key values, and decide which history needs to remain available.

04

Plan the switch

Agree the cutover window, treatment of new edits, user training, and stop or rollback criteria before changing the live workflow.

CHOOSE THE RIGHT APPROACH

When a custom build makes sense.

Keep a spreadsheet when a small team can use it reliably and the work remains simple. A configured tool may be enough when its process fits. Consider a custom application when shared access, auditability, business rules, and integrations create recurring operational problems.

BEFORE YOU DECIDE

Practical questions.

Can you convert every formula automatically?

We assess the formulas and the business decisions they encode. Some can become application rules; others need clarification or redesign. We do not promise a one-click conversion.

Will we lose historical data?

The migration scope defines what to retain, move, or archive. A trial import and agreed validation checks come before the live switch. Data quality and source access affect what can be migrated.

Is custom software always the right replacement?

No. Improving the workbook, adding a small automation, or configuring an existing tool may solve the problem. We assess those options before recommending a custom build.
